Hi There,
I'm trying to build a version of ThinStation to auto start FreeRDP but i can't seem to get a few of the ThinStation Config options working in the build time config file when autostart freerdp is set to on So my question is there a way to change the config file to autostart once i make my changes to the config then somehow to turn autostart of FreeRDP on? The 2 options i can't see to get working at Dual Display (can only get it working if i set it in the display properties when i run without autostart turned on) and Audio Input (when i go in to sound properties it is always set to mute once i turn off mute it works) Thanks Harvey J. FreeRDP by default autostart tries to go to fullscreen (set in /etc/cmd/freerdp.global with /f) Can change by settings MAXIMIZE_DEFAULT=window However, without a window manager, many graphical applications won't have access to all the video support. Try MIC_LEVEL and possibly MIC_DEVICE (if not the default Mic). See the alsa package configuration. On Wed, Jun 21, 2017 at 9:15 AM, Harvey Jacobs <[hidden email]> wrote:
